Section 7:14A-12.5 - Disinfection

Universal Citation: NJ Admin Code 7:14A-12.5

Current through Register Vol. 56, No. 24, December 18, 2024

(a) All wastewater that could contain pathogenic organisms such as fecal coliform and/or enterococci organisms shall be subject to continuous year round disinfection prior to discharge into surface waters.

(b) The State effluent standard for fecal coliform organisms is as follows:

1. The monthly geometric mean shall not exceed 200 colonies/100 mL; and

2. The weekly geometric mean shall not exceed 400 colonies/100 mL.
